Broadband Internet Access, aka broadband, enable your high speed Internet access. ADSL (Asymmetric Digital Subscriber Line) is a type of broadband. ADSL uses telephone lines but on a different frequency so it can be used at the same time as the telephone.

Upload Speed
The upload speed is the speed at which data (e.g. photographs) are uploaded to the internet (e.g. when you load your photographs onto a website). Upload speeds are slower than download speeds. The reason for this is that people generally do far more downloading. If you are looking for high upload speeds, a private data circuit may suit you as you can upload and download at up to 100Mb/sec.

A static IP address is a unique number which gives a computer a permanent address on the Internet and is more suited for more advanced Internet usage such as:
- Running a local email server for your inbound or outbound mail
- Running a local web server as well as being able to generate traffic statistics
- Running Virtual Private Networks (VPNs) and authentication for secure access to protected web sites
- Using video conferencing services
- Accessing your PC from anywhere with remote desktop software
- Running other services or applications that requires external access such as IP based security cameras
